HOW AND WHAT WILL I LEARN?

There are five levels of qualifications within the Functional English Curriculum:

  • Entry Levels 1, 2 and 3
  • Level 1 which is the equivalent of a GCSE grade D to G
  • Level 2 which is the equivalent of a GCSE grade A to C

Applicants will have a confidential interview with a member of the Skills for Life team to assess their current English level and agree on a suitable level of course to study.

Following their interview learners will begin their course attending a 3 hour session once a week.

Entry 1/2/3 Course Outline

  • Speak to communicate, engage in discussions and listen for and identify information
  • Read and understand texts, find relevant information, read familiar topics in newspapers and understand everyday signs and symbols
  • Improve letter writing and spelling, improve sentences using punctuation correctly and be able to proofread your work

 

Level 1/2 Course Outline

  • Listen for instructions, engage in discussions using facts and opinions and make relevant contributions
  • Identify different types of text using different reading strategies to locate information and analyse text to evaluate effectiveness
  • Write for different purposes and audience using appropriate language, improve spelling by using a variety of strategies and improve proofreading skills in order to produce accurate pieces of writing
